Sign In Pricing Add Podcast

Ofri Bibas


Global News Podcast

Bibas family funeral takes place in Israel


Forgiveness means accepting responsibility and committing to act differently, to learn from mistakes. There is no meaning to forgiveness before the failures are investigated and all officials take responsibility. A disaster as a nation and as a family should not have happened and must never happen again.